I have been using TDA v2.1.9.90 for a while to author single layer discs and have gotten fairly comfortable with it. I'd now like to try my hand at DL discs and am wondering if any authoring apps allow you to select the layer break point. I've read other posts and guides on doing that with PGC Edit, etc., but would prefer to be able to do it during the authoring process if possible, although I know that TDA doesn't support this.
Any comments/suggestions are appreciated.

RABinMS,
I know that ImgBurn is not part of the authoring process and I am sure you are aware of its capabilities but thought I would mention it just in case.
It does allow several options for for layer breaks and even gives you a preview option to see where the layer break will occcur.
You could use this as a manual input into the current authoring app. These steps do add a bit more work, but, if there are no other options, here is a possibility.
